In time for the holidays, Amazon and Hyundai launch online car sales platform

Amazon and Hyundai Motor Co. have officially launched their collaboration to bring Hyundai vehicle sales online, enabling car buyers in 48 U.S. cities to browse, finance, and schedule the pickup of a new car directly on Amazon.

This follows a strategic partnership announced last year, in which Hyundai also designated Amazon Web Services (AWS) as its preferred cloud provider for digital transformation efforts.

Amazon is No. 1 in the Top 1000 Database. The database is Digital Commerce 360’s ranking of the largest online retailers in North America by annual web sales. Amazon is also No. 3 in Digital Commerce 360’s Global Online Marketplaces Database, which ranks the 100 largest global marketplaces by third-party gross merchandise value (GMV).

“We’re partnering with dealers and brands to redesign car shopping — making it more transparent, convenient, and customer-friendly,” said Fan Jin, global head of Amazon Autos.

Currently, Amazon Autos focuses on new Hyundai vehicles but plans to expand in 2024 to include additional automotive brands, leasing options, broader financing tools, and increased city coverage. The platform aims to simplify the car-buying experience for consumers while offering dealerships a new avenue to reach customers.
